## Deployment — Gatecount

Gatecount tallies turnstile pulses at the Brindlehall arena and publishes per-gate totals every second. Deploy via the standard container pipeline; one replica per stand, pinned to the edge nodes. Health endpoint must return green before traffic shifts. Reviewer: verify the values below match the release manifest exactly.

config for tagep-yajef:
ulawyn:
  log_level: error
  metrics_host: metrics.ulawyn.lumiclabs.internal
  pin: 0564
  pool_size: 32

**Vendor note: Inkmill markdown pipeline**

Rendering for Parchway docs is outsourced to Inkmill under an annual contract, renewing each March. They handle sanitization and PDF export; we own the upload queue. SLA: 4-hour response on rendering failures. Escalate only after two failed retries. Their support desk is reachable at the address below.

billing contact of hahaf-baguf = zorael.tammir.jorius@sivrelhq.internal

## ReceiptRelay Environments

Hey, quick orientation for the next release train. ReceiptRelay is the donation-receipt mailer behind Givewell Harbor's portal, and it has four environments: sandbox, qa, staging, and prod. Sandbox uses a fake SMTP sink, so don't panic if nothing arrives. Staging sends real mail to an internal-only distribution, which makes it the safest place to validate templates before you cut prod. Promote configs in order — no skipping qa this time. The staging configuration is as follows.

settings of fafog-haduf:
ZORIX_PIN=4648
ZORIX_METRICS_HOST=metrics.zorix.paliqsys.corp
ZORIX_LOG_LEVEL=info
ZORIX_TENANT=druix

Ticket #4471 — Signature check fails on Sheetforge export plugin

Hey plugin folks — builds of the Sheetforge memory-optimized export module are failing verification since Tuesday. Looks like the exporter was re-signed after we trimmed memory usage in the streaming writer, but the manifest still references the old digest. Verification now rejects every upload. Workaround for external authors: re-sign against the updated manifest before publishing. For convenience, the current signing key is included here.

rollout seal: bky4_x7Gc